TO THE HONORABLE JUDGES OF SAID COURT:
1. Your Petitioner, Matthew Scott Manning, is an individual residing at 1820 Mountain Road,
Newburg, Cumberland County, Pennsylvania, 17240.
2. On or about January 25, 2000, Petitioner received a Notice from the Pennsylvania
Department of Transportation notifying him that his present operator's license, bearing card number
23192804, was being suspended for a period of one year, effective December 7, 2010. A true and correct
copy of said notice is attached hereto, made a part hereof and marked as Exhibit "A.",
3. Said Suspension arises out of the Petitioner's alleged chemical test refusal which occurred
on or about January 9, 2000.
4. Petitioner has a corresponding criminal preliminary hearing arising out of this incident,
which was scheduled for the first time by District Justice Helen B. Shulenberger, to occur on March 2,
2000. made a part hereof and marked as Exhibit "B".
,.~,,"o,- -. _',_"'0;,__' .
0"-
-- --"--,""..- ,'- ,::'".( - --,.-.. - . ',.",-~:~'~
-<_c~X':;"i' .~,,-,,-,
, ,
5. Petitioner had his initial attorney client conference on February 25, 2000 at 0930 hours.
6. Petitioner was unaware that he was required to file this appeal prior to meeting with his
attorney.
7. Petitioner alleges that a third party was driving the vehicle and will offer evidence to that
I
!,
I
1
"
i
~
i'
!i
assertion at the time of the hearing.
8. Petitioner has suffered serious head and facial injuries and alleges that a knowing and
conscious chemical test refusal could not have occurred on January 9, 2000.
9. Petitioner respectfully request permission to proceed with this Appeal Nunc Pro Tunc, as
I:
~
I
I
t
there will be no prejudice to the Commonwealth by allowing this Appeal which is less than twenty-four
(24) hours late, but was in fact immediately filed within six (6) hours, of the Defendant becoming aware
of his suspension, after his initial client conference with Counsel.
WHEREFORE, your Petitioner respectfully request that this Honorable Court allow this Nunc
Pro Tunc appeal to proceed, and in the interim, this Honorable Court enter a stay of the suspension of
Petitioners operating privileges pending a hearing of this appeal.

ORDER
AND NOW, this
J.... L{ ft. day of
, 2000, upon
tf1.1 7J I' l
consideration of the Department's Response to Rule to Show, this Court fmds that the appeal
was not filed and perfected within the thirty (30) days allowed by law. Accordingly, the license
suspension appeal is quashed and dismissed for want of jurisdiction.
The Department of Transportation, Bureau of Driver Licensing, is hereby ordered to
reinstate the suspension which is the subject of this appeal.

D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ION'S RESPONSE TO RULE TO SHOW CAUSE
AND NOW comes the Department of Transportation (hereinafter referred to as
"Department") by and through its attorney, George H. Kabusk, Assistant Counsel, and hereby
responds to the Order of Court dated March 1, 2000, as follows:
1. The Department of Transportation notified the petitioner by notice dated January 25,
2000, that as a result of his violation of Section 1547 of the Vehicle Code, Chemical Test
Refusal, on January 9, 2000, his driving privilege was being suspended for a period of
one year effective December 7,2010.
2. On February 25, 2000, the petitioner, Matthew Scott Manning, filed a Petition for Appeal
Nunc Pro Tunc from a notice of suspension dated January 25, 2000.
3. On March 1,2000, an Order was issued upon the Department to show cause why the
petitioner should not be permitted to appeal his license suspension nunc pro tunc.
CiWIOI
~ I
~~"
.
4. Mr. Manning's appeal is untimely.
5. An appeal of a license suspension must be filed within thirty days of the mailing date of
the Department's Notice of Suspension. See 75 Pa. C.S.{l1550 and 42 Pa. C.S. {l{l5571,
5572; Bye v. Department of Transportation, Bureau of Driver Licensing, 147 Pa.
Commw. 205, 607 A.2d 325 (1992).
6. Failure to file the appeal within the thirty-day appeal period deprives the court of
jurisdiction to entertain the merits of the case. See Department of Transportation,
Bureau of Motor Vehicles v. Shemer, 157 Pa. Commw. 380, 629 A.2d 1063 (1993),
appeal denied, 536 Pa. 635, 637 A.2d 294 (1993), (appeal quashed when filed one day
after the expiration of the 30 day appeal period.); Kulick v. Department of
Transportation, Bureau of Driver Licensing, 666 A.2d 1148 (Pa. Cmwlth. 1995), appeal
denied, 544 Pa. 616, 674 A.2d 1077 (1996).
7. An appeal nunc pro tunc may only be allowed when there is proof of extraordinary
circumstances involving fraud or breakdown of administrative or judicial system which
causes the late filing. Maxion v. Department of Transportation, Bureau of Driver
Licensing, 728 A.2d 442 (pa. Cmwlth. 1999); Kulick v. Department of Transportation,
Bureau of Driver Licensing, 666 A.2d 1148 (Pa. Cmwlth. 1995), appeal denied, 544 Pa.
616,674 A.2d 1077 (1996); Department of Transportation, Bureau of Traffic Safety v.
Rick, 75 Pa. Conunw. 514, 462 A.2d 902 (1983).
8. The petitioner's alleged reason for allowance of appeal nunc pro tunc, that reason being
he was unaware that he was required to file an appeal prior to meeting with his attorney,
is not an extraordinary circumstance involving fraud or the breakdown of the system
meriting granting a nunc pro tunc appeal.
